Walter A. Britten

March 16, 2002

Walter A. "Bud" Britten, 62, of 95 Strong Ave. died Saturday evening at Berkshire Medical Center after a long illness.

Born in Saratoga Springs, N.Y., on Aug. 9, 1939, son of John H. and Jeanne Dunlavey Britten, he attended school there and was a 1958 graduate of Saratoga Springs High School. He moved to Pittsfield in 1969.

He was a Marine Corps veteran and served at Guantanamo Bay during the Cuban missile crisis.

Mr. Britten was employed by GE as head of the material management branch at naval ordnance on Plastics Avenue for 35 years, retiring in 1990 because of ill health. He also had worked in Washington for the Naval Department Special Projects Office.

He was a communicant of St. Teresa's Church and a member of Charles Persip American Legion Post 68. He coached hockey at the Boys' Club in Pittsfield and Lenox for more than 10 years. He enjoyed golfing and going to beaches.

He and his wife, the former Nancy H. Stevens, celebrated their 38th wedding anniversary Jan. 8.

Besides his wife, he leaves two sons, Michael J. Britten of Northampton and John A. Britten of Hinsdale; two sisters, MaryEllen "Sue" Carvalho and Patricia MacDermid, both of Saratoga Springs, and two granddaughters.
